From: ivan Date: Tue, 5 Feb 2002 20:25:32 +0000 (+0000) Subject: better error messages if you haven't run fs-setup ? X-Git-Tag: freeside_1_4_0pre11~101 X-Git-Url: http://git.freeside.biz/gitweb/?p=freeside.git;a=commitdiff_plain;h=b6c28c086832416944440cab39f3bffc9d3dd1f1 better error messages if you haven't run fs-setup ? --- diff --git a/FS/FS/Record.pm b/FS/FS/Record.pm index 4286606f0..755cef830 100644 --- a/FS/FS/Record.pm +++ b/FS/FS/Record.pm @@ -1014,7 +1014,8 @@ I<$FS::Record::setup_hack> is true. Returns a DBIx::DBSchema object. sub reload_dbdef { my $file = shift || $dbdef_file; - $dbdef = load DBIx::DBSchema $file; + $dbdef = load DBIx::DBSchema $file + or die "can't load database schema from $file"; } =item dbdef